Material Composition

Because the materials inside a dessert plate determine how it looks, feels, and lasts, you’ll want to understand what bone china is made of before you buy. Bone china often contains a high proportion of bone ash, usually around 30 to 60 percent, and that gives the plate a warm ivory color and a gentle translucency when held to light. The bone ash also lowers density, so the plate stays light and thin while keeping strength and chip resistance. Makers fire it at high heat and often double fire to build a nonporous glaze that resists stains. You’ll find bone china tougher than earthenware in impact and thermal shock, yet still more delicate than stoneware. Check safety certifications to avoid heavy metal risks.

Size And Shape

After you’ve looked at what bone china is made of and how that affects strength and translucency, it helps to think about size and shape since they change how your desserts look and how easy the plates are to use. Pick a diameter that fits your portions and storage. Standard dessert plates run about 7.5 to 8.5 inches, so choose what feels right for your cakes and tarts. Think about depth and rim width. Shallow, flat plates show off slices, while a 0.5 to 1 inch raised rim keeps sauces tidy. Match shape to presentation. Round works for everyday, square or oval gives more room for sauces and garnish. Also check stackability and how plates pass at the table. If you use chargers, leave a 2 to 3 inch gap for balance.

Durability And Strength

If you want plates that look delicate but stand up to real use, focus on strength and how the piece was made. You’ll find bone china gets strength from bone ash and high firing temperatures, so it resists chips more than many porcelains. Choose thinner pieces if you like a light feel; they often stay strong while weighing about 30% less than regular ceramic. Pay attention to double-fired or vitrified finishes because they cut porosity and help with thermal shock and staining. Be mindful if the plate has metallic trim since gold or platinum wears and won’t go in the microwave, and needs gentler cleaning. Follow care labels closely because hot washes, harsh detergents, or repeated microwave use can weaken surfaces and cause cracks over time.

Microwave And Dishwasher

When you’re choosing bone china dessert plates, thinking about microwave and dishwasher use can save you headaches and keep your favorite dishes looking great. Check the manufacturer’s care instructions first, since many pieces are safe for both but some are not. If plates have gold, silver, or platinum trim, don’t use them in the microwave and plan to hand wash to prevent sparking and tarnish. If the label says dishwasher-safe, run a gentle cycle with low heat and mild detergent to protect glaze and painted patterns. Avoid sudden temperature changes like freezer to hot liquid to prevent cracking. In the dishwasher, secure plates so they don’t knock together, use lower rack spacing, and never use abrasive cleaners or scouring pads.
